Loop Antennas

Loop antennas may be constructed in many forms including horizontal full wave loops in square, rectangle or triangle (delta) shapes.  They can also be in the vertical plane and are most often in the same shapes with the delta being very popular as it has both vertical and horizontal polarization.  The impedance at the loop resonant frequency is approximately 100 ohms but will very slightly on harmonics.  Loops are “quiet” antennas compared to verticals and dipoles and are omni-directional.  The also exhibit gain on harmonic bands.  Once you try a loop antenna you will know why they are so popular with old timers but still a secret to newcomers.  Shown below are some typical designs:

 

Full Wave Horizontal Loop Antenna (a.k.a Skyloop)

This antenna is horizontally polarized and should be mounted as high as possible but works well at low heights of 10-30 feet.  They are quieter than a dipole or a vertical, have a broader bandwidth and will usually out perform a dipole antenna.To determine the approximate circumference in feet of a full wave loop antenna use the formula:

1005/Freq in Mhz = length in feet.

The feed point impedance of a full wave loop antenna is theoretically in the vicinity of 120 ohms and requires a 2:1 impedance transformer (for single band loops or a 4:1 balun to match on multiple bands) with 50 ohm line.  You will also need a feed line choke or better yet, just get the Hybrid 4:1+1:1 in a single box.

Vertical Delta Loops

Vertical delta loops can be oriented several way but the most popular is to have the “pointy” end at the top (usually a single support) and the lower horizontal ends just out of reach of humans and animals.  Best feed point is 1/4 wavelength (246/f(mhz)) from the top point down one side.  Vertical delta loops use the same 2:1 baluns as the horizontal loops or 4:1 for multi-band operation.

INSTALLATION

For best results support center at 30+ feet and ends over 15 feet. Angle of feed each side must be great than 45 degrees or 120 – 180 degrees total between each side preferred. Any length of 50 ohm feed line ok (from the matching unit) but longer feed lines over 50 feet may show reduced SWR on some bands due to losses in feed line and soil conductivity, nearby objects, etc. Due to local ground conditions, antenna height and feed line length, SWR may vary from samples shown and an antenna tuner may be required or some bands to bring SWR at end of feed line to acceptable levels.

Antenna Length Note:These antennas are shipped from the factory with each side at 46 feet long (92 feet total) so that you may adjust(shorten) the length for your personal installation.The SWR graph shown for this product is for a side length of 44 feet as this length provides a lower SWR in the 17 meter band than the 46 foot length. The longer 46 foot length tends to shift the SWR curves to the left (lower frequency) which can sometimes be offset by reducing the length of the ladder line (up to 2 feet max). Each antenna installation is unique – try the antenna lengths as received and shorten the wire length by bending back the wires on themselves at the ends as needed.

Use an antenna tuner for 80, 30, 15 meters and reduce power if balun saturation occurs.
